The WD Black SN750 SE – here tested in the 500 GB version – is a PCIe 4.0 SSD. Its performance is modest in terms of performance, but it is counterbalanced by very good thermal management which gives it good flow resistance over time; a good point for use in a PC gaming or in a Sony PS5 console – then you have to add a third-party heat sink to it.

The WD Black SN750 is an excellent SSD, like the SN700 model which it replaces and from which it incorporates all the components. Releasing a carbon copy under the guise of software optimization is always a bit of a shame, but that does not detract from the intrinsic qualities of this model: high speeds, efficient thermal management, endurance and warranty remain still and always on top.
